Add Worksheet In Excel Pandas
Workbook filenamexlsx worksheet1 workbook. You can install this library using below command in Jupyter notebook.
The Python Add In For Microsoft Excel Pyxll Python Excel Data Science
Instead a new worksheet is created by calling the add_worksheet method from a Workbook object.

Add worksheet in excel pandas. Df pdread_excelpath_to_excel_file sheet_name. Save I could see eventually adding an option to ExcelWriter that doesnt overwrite the file. First off to run Python code in Exce l you need the PyXLL add-in.
34 firstMockDF pdDataFramefirstMockData firstMockDFto_exceltest_wbxlsx sheetA indexFalse We. PandasDataFrameadd_prefix pandasDataFrameadd_suffix pandasDataFramealign pandasDataFrameat_time pandasDataFramebetween_time pandasDataFramedrop pandasDataFramedrop_duplicates pandasDataFrameduplicated pandasDataFrameequals pandasDataFramefilter pandasDataFramefirst. From openpyxl import Workbook workbook Workbook sheet workbookactive sheetA1 hello sheetB1 world workbooksavefilenamehello_worldxlsx The code above should create a file called hello_worldxlsx in the folder you are using to run the code.
Necessary modules needed for this and how to set them up in your system. Set the working folder to the same folder as the script oschdir ospathdirname ospathabspath __file__ test send_request content df pdread_csv ioStringIO testdecode utf-8 writer pdExcelWriter NHL_STATS_JSB_finalxlsx engine xlsxwriter dfto_excel writer Player statistics indexFalse writersave. To_excel writer Data 1 writer.
This method requires you to know the sheet names in advance. Import pandas as pd import openpyxl as pxl firstMockData a. To make this easy the pandas read_excel method takes an argument called sheetname that tells pandas which sheet to read in the data from.
I have a worksheet which I have read into a dataframe and the applied forward fill ffill method to. From openpyxl import load_workbook Workbook import pandas as pd df pdDataFramedata 20-01-201849162536columns DateABCDE path. Pip install xlwt.
A data frame can be added as a new sheet to an existing excel sheet. The right way to do this is to use ExcelWriter. In this article you will learn how to use Pandas to work with Excel spreadsheets.
The simplest way to read Excel files into pandas data frames is by using the following function assuming you did import pandas as pd. Workbook xlsxwriter. Sheet numbers start with zero.
If the sheetname argument is not given it defaults to zero and pandas will import the first sheet. Reading data from excel file into pandas using Python. Combine Multiple Excel Worksheets Into a Single Pandas Dataframe Creating a dataframe using Excel files Decimal Functions in Python Set 2.
Insert pandas DataFrame into existing excel worksheet with styling. The purpose of the code is to copy in a standard Instructions sheet into the sales_summary file we created using pandas. 3 6 6 create a Pandas Excel writer using XlsxWriter as the.
Once those are installed you can easily write several pandas DataFrames to multiple Excel sheets. To_excel writer Data 0 df. 13 15 15 17 22 24 29 30 df3 pdDataFrame dataset.
Import pandas as pd create three DataFrames df1 pdDataFrame dataset. Import pandas as pd df pdread_excel usersxlsx sheet_name 012 df pdread_excel usersxlsx sheet_name User_infocompound df pdread_excel usersxlsx sheet_name None read all sheets. The same command can be executed in command prompt without the exclamation character.
Workbook writerbook worksheet writersheetsSheet1. To install the PyXLL Excel add-in pip install pyxll and then use the PyXLL command line tool to. Exploring the data from excel files in Pandas.
August 30 2018 at 0750 AM. Most of the time you will read in a specific sheet from an Excel file. Import pandas as pd Create a Pandas dataframe from the data.
A B C D E df2 pdDataFrame dataset. From win32comclient import DispatchEx excel DispatchExExcelApplication excelVisible False workbook_1 excelWorkbooksOpenrCfullpathtosales_summaryxlsx workbook_2 excelWorkbooksOpenrCfullpathtosales_templatexlsx workbook_2WorksheetsInstructionsMoveBeforeworkbook_1Worksheets. Add_worksheet worksheet1.
Add worksheet to existing Excel file with pandas. For this operation the library required is openpyxl. Add_worksheet worksheet2 workbook.
At the end of the article you will have the knowledge of. The PyXLL add-in is what lets us integrate Python into Excel and use Python instead of VBA. Ive seen answers as to how to add a pandas DataFrame into an existing worksheet using openpyxl as shown below.
For this you can either use the sheet name or the sheet number. Just started using pandas and python. I would then like to create a single excel document with two worksheets.
Write A1 123 workbook. Dfto_excelwriter sheet_nameSheet1 Get the xlsxwriter objects from the dataframe writer object. 10 20 30 20 15 30 45 Create a Pandas Excel writer using XlsxWriter as the engine.
Import pandas as pd writer pd. Writer pdExcelWriterpandas_simplexlsx enginexlsxwriter Convert the dataframe to an XlsxWriter Excel object.
Creating A Complex Excel Worksheet In Python Stack Overflow
Creating Advanced Excel Workbooks With Python Practical Business Python
To Do List In 2020 Excel For Beginners To Do List List
How To Move Data From One Excel File To Another Using Python By Todd Q Brannon The Startup Medium
Could You Be Replaced By A Robot Or An Excel File Excel Pivot Table Excel Spreadsheets
Example Pandas Excel With Multiple Dataframes Xlsxwriter Documentation
Combine Multiple Excel Worksheets Into A Single Pandas Dataframe Practical Business Python
Analysis Toolpak In Excel Excel Tutorials Data Analytics Tools Data Analysis Tools
Pandas How To Read And Write Files Reading Writing Reading Writing
How To Create Excel Data Entry Form With Userform That Calculates Income Tax Full Tutorial In 2021 Income Tax Income Coding
How To Add A Lot Of Goal Seeking To A Model Data Analytics Ads Goals
Learning The Pandas Library Python Tools For Data Munging Analysis And Visual
Combine Multiple Excel Worksheets Into A Single Pandas Dataframe Practical Business Python
Two Pandas Functions You Must Know For Easy Data Manipulation In Python Data Science Quadratics Linear Relationships
Pandas Cheat Sheet Python For Data Science Pandas Is A Data Centric Python Package It S Common When Python Cheat Sheet Data Science Data Science Learning
Example Pandas Excel Output With A Worksheet Table Xlsxwriter Documentation
Python Write Values In All Worksheets Of Existing Excel File Useful Code
A Guide To Excel Spreadsheets In Python With Openpyxl Excel Spreadsheets Excel Spreadsheet